Web28 Feb 2024 · To remove a user from a fixed server role, use sp_dropsrvrolemember. Users cannot be removed from the public role, and dbo cannot be removed from any role. Use … Web28 Feb 2024 · A core concept of SQL Server security is that owners of objects have irrevocable permissions to administer them. You can … Web29 Dec 2024 · Removes a SQL Server login account. Transact-SQL syntax conventions Syntax syntaxsql DROP LOGIN login_name Note To view Transact-SQL syntax for SQL Server 2014 and earlier, see Previous versions documentation. Arguments login_name Specifies the name of the login to be dropped. Remarks A login cannot be dropped while it is logged in.

Web28 Feb 2024 · To remove a user from a fixed server role, use sp_dropsrvrolemember. Users cannot be removed from the public role, and dbo cannot be removed from any role. Use sp_helpuser to see the members of a SQL Server role, and use ALTER ROLE to add a member to a role. Permissions Requires ALTER permission on the role.
